IRFB13N50APBF 技术参数

是否无铅: 不含铅是否Rohs认证: 符合
生命周期:Active零件包装代码:TO-220AB
包装说明:FLANGE MOUNT, R-PSFM-T3针数:3
Reach Compliance Code:compliant风险等级:0.8
雪崩能效等级(Eas):560 mJ外壳连接:DRAIN
配置:SINGLE WITH BUILT-IN DIODE最小漏源击穿电压:500 V
最大漏极电流 (Abs) (ID):14 A最大漏极电流 (ID):14 A
最大漏源导通电阻:0.45 ΩFET 技术:METAL-OXIDE SEMICONDUCTOR
JEDEC-95代码:TO-220ABJESD-30 代码:R-PSFM-T3
JESD-609代码:e3元件数量:1
端子数量:3工作模式:ENHANCEMENT MODE
最高工作温度:150 °C封装主体材料:PLASTIC/EPOXY
封装形状:RECTANGULAR封装形式:FLANGE MOUNT
峰值回流温度(摄氏度):260极性/信道类型:N-CHANNEL
最大功率耗散 (Abs):250 W最大脉冲漏极电流 (IDM):56 A
认证状态:Not Qualified子类别:FET General Purpose Power
表面贴装:NO端子面层:Matte Tin (Sn)
端子形式:THROUGH-HOLE端子位置:SINGLE
处于峰值回流温度下的最长时间:40晶体管应用:SWITCHING
晶体管元件材料:SILICONBase Number Matches:1

Notes  
a. Repetitive rating; pulse width limited by maximum junction temperature (see fig. 11).  
b. Starting TJ = 25 °C, L = 5.7 mH, RG = 25 Ω, IAS =14 A, dV/dt = 7.6 V/ns (see fig. 12a).  
c. ISD 14 A, dI/dt 250 A/µs, VDD VDS, TJ 150 °C.  
d. 1.6 mm from case.
